Starting Point and Logistics
The tour kicks off from the south part of Favignana in a private dock at 10:30 AM, giving travelers a chance to start their day with a welcome drink (alcohol-free). The tour’s flexibility is notable—depending on weather conditions, the skipper chooses the best route, either clockwise or counter-clockwise. This decision ensures safety and comfort, but it also means that the route might change day-to-day, which keeps the experience fresh and responsive.
The boat accommodates a maximum of 8 people, making it a cozy, intimate setting. For larger groups or those seeking privacy, the boat can be booked exclusively for a customized experience. Reviewers mention that this setup allows for a more relaxed, personalized day, with plenty of space to spread out and enjoy the scenery.
The Itinerary: A Day of Relaxed Exploration
The core of this tour revolves around multiple bathing stops in some of the islands’ most secluded beaches. These spots are prized for their uncrowded, pristine conditions—perfect for swimming, snorkeling, and marine life viewing.
After a brief introduction, the boat stops for the first swim, with subsequent stops scheduled until lunchtime. Reviewers highlight that the timing at each stop is flexible, depending on weather and the group’s preferences, allowing for a tailored experience. Some travelers appreciated the chance to snorkel in clear waters and marvel at the marine life, which is easier to do away from crowded beaches.

What’s Included and What’s Not
The price covers food, beverages, fuel, transfers, and external shower facilities—a solid package that emphasizes value. Extras like professional photoshoots or private experiences are available at an additional cost, providing options for personalization.
Not included are special food requests or drinks outside the standard offerings, as well as private tours, which require advance contact. It’s worth noting that the tour is suitable for people with reduced mobility, although travelers are advised to inquire further for specific needs.
Practical Tips and Considerations
Travelers should bring sunglasses, towels, sunscreen, waterproof cameras, beachwear, and snorkeling gear. Shoes, high heels, bikes, and fireworks are not allowed on board, aligning with safety and comfort. Since the boat is designed for up to 8 guests, it’s perfect for small groups or intimate family outings.
In case of bad sea forecasts, the skipper has the authority to cancel or reschedule, so flexible planning is advised. The tour also offers free taxi transfers for those struggling to reach the private dock, which can be a real convenience.
